Police arrest Hull boy, 15, after sacks of post stolen from Royal Mail vans
Yorkshire Post
A 15-year-old boy from Hull has been arrested by police investigating the theft of post. Humberside Police today said that two sacks of post had been stolen from Royal Mail Delivery vans. A spokesman said officers wanted to hear from anyone with
